Job Description

The Product Counsel – Global Data Protection serves as a key leader in developing and maturing the Global Data Protection Product Compliance Program within Motorola Solutions, Inc. (“MSI”). While the Product Counsel will report to the Sr. Director, Global Data Protection – Products, he/she will also work closely and collaboratively with the internal product, engineering, security and business teams to advise on the implementation of privacy and information security measures into new and existing products and services.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Provide advice and counsel to product teams on relevant global privacy and security laws, standards and policies

  • Conduct assessments of new and existing products and services to advise on the privacy and security compliance implications and develop ways to mitigate compliance risks

  • Provide proactive and creative legal guidance to facilitate launch of new and innovative products and services while ensuring all privacy and data protection risks are properly mitigated

  • Maintain expertise in global data and privacy laws and advise on the impact to MSI as well as implications with respect to compliance activities

  • develop/implement corrective action plans for resolution of problematic issues

  • Develop and provide training to product teams regarding privacy, security and other compliance best practices and obligations

  • Develop internal controls and conduct periodic self-assessments to ensure MSI’s products and services are supporting our customer’s compliance obligations with applicable laws, standards and policies as well as our own

  • Legal analysis in connection with data protection impact assessments and records of processing activities

  • Support security and other teams in responding to any data security incident responses

  • Engage with privacy regulators as may be required

  • Provide reports as directed or requested to keep senior management, DPO and other groups informed of the operation and progress of compliance efforts

  • Serve as data protection subject matter expert in connection with domestic and international sales and legal teams responding to requests for proposals or other customer solicitations as needed

SKILLS AND QUALIFICATIONS

  • Juris Doctorate Degree

  • Active member of a State Bar Association with authorization to practice within the state in which the employee works

  • 8+ years of work experience as an attorney for private law firm and/or as in-house counsel; direct experience advising global product and engineering teams on integrating privacy and security into new and existing products and services

  • CIPP/US, CIPP/E and CIPM certifications strongly preferred

  • A security certification (CISSP, Security +) is desirable

  • Working knowledge of global data and privacy laws and standards, including but not limited to CCPA, GDPR, HIPAA, EU directives on electronic commerce, data retention and law enforcement, CPNI (state and federal), NIST Privacy Framework, NIST 800-53 r5, ISO 27001, et seq, and SOC2 trust criteria

  • General understanding of cloud industry technologies, IaaS, PaaS and SaaS required

  • Prior experience advising product teams in connection with development and use of artificial intelligence technologies preferred

  • Practical yet creative problem-solving approach that emphasizes addressing business needs while protecting companies interests
